People who moan about them are just killjoys. London is one of the greatest cities on the planet, we need to show it off and if this means dressing it up with colour then so be it. Each bulb used is sponsored and the money goes to charity, so they are a worthy cause. Other cities (New York shops, Champs Elysees in Paris) dress themselves in luminescent colour - why do people moan about London?

Personally though, I like the Carnaby Street lights as they are always avant garde and strange. One year it was giant LED bulbs. Last year it was hanging 'shards' of light which looked like 'something out of a provincial discotheque.'
